CUET Physics 2023 Syllabus
As mentioned earlier, syllabus is one the most important aspects that students have to keep in mind for thorough preparation for CUET Physics 2023. One can check the detailed syllabus of Physics 2023 which is divided into ten units as mentioned below:
Units |
Name |
I |
Electrostatic |
II |
Current Electricity |
III |
Magnetic Effects of Current and Magnetism |
IV |
Electromagnetic Induction and Alternating Currents |
V |
Electromagnetic Waves |
VI |
Optics |
VII |
Dual Nature of Matter and Radiation |
VIII |
Atoms and Nuclei |
IX |
Electronic Devices |
X |
Communication Systems |
CUET Physics 2023 Preparation Tips
CUET Physics 2023 examination will be conducted for all the aspirants who will apply for the course. The level of competition will be very high and one must take care of the important CUET 2023 preparation tips to score very good marks in the CUET 2023 exams. We have provided all the important preparation strategy for CUET Physics 2023 below.
- The students must make separate notes of all the formulae at one place so that they can revise them in one go as the question for Physics includes a lot of numericals.
- If any candidate is not very confident about the numerical part, then they should take up the theoretical topics first such as Wave Optics, Communication, Nuclei, etc.
- If the strength of the student is numerical calculations, then they should first complete the chapters such as Electric Charge and Fields, Electrostatic Potential and Capacitance, Magnetism, etc. from CUET Physics 2023 syllabus.
- Revision is very important and makes a huge difference in raising the confidence of the aspirants. They must make a separate notebook of difficult questions from different topics, important formulas, and highlights of all the chapters for revising before the examination.
- One must practice as many mock test papers as possible and must solve previous year question papers for time management and effective preparation of the topics.
CUET Physics 2023 Scoring Topics and their Weightage
The aspirants appearing for CUET Physics 2023 must have a thorough idea about not only units and syllabus but also about the scoring topics for scoring maximum marks in the CUET entrance examination. The below mentioned table can be checked to get the details of CUET Physics important topics unit wise and their weightage as per the trends of the questions asked in the previous years of CUET Physics exam.
Units |
Important Topics |
Weightage (Percentage) |
---|---|---|
Electrostatics |
Electric field, Electric flux, Electric potential, Conductors and insulators |
8 % |
Current Electricity |
Ohm’s law, Kirchhoff’s laws and their applications, Potentiometer, Carbon resistors colour code, series and parallel combination |
12% |
Magnetic Effects of Current and Magnetism |
Toroidal solenoids, cyclotron, the definition of ampere, dipole moment, Para-, dia- and ferromagnetic substances, Oersted’s experiment, Biot - Savart law, Ampere’s law etc. |
12% |
Electromagnetic Induction and Alternating Currents |
Electromagnetic induction, Alternating currents, reactance, impedance, resonance, LCR circuit, AC generator and transformer, Faraday’s law, Lenz’s Law |
8% |
Electromagnetic Waves |
Displacement current, electromagnetic spectrum, Transverse waves |
10% |
Optics |
Reflection, Refraction, Scattering of light, Optical instruments, Microscopes and astronomical telescopes, Interference, Diffraction, Polarisation |
12% |
Dual Nature of Matter and Radiation |
Einstein’s photoelectric equation, de Broglie relation. Davisson-Germer experiment |
8% |
Atoms and Nuclei |
Alpha-particle scattering experiment, Rutherford’s model of atom, Bohr model, Radioactivity |
10% |
Electronic Devices |
Energy bands in solids, I-V characteristics, Zener diode, Logic gates, conductors, insulators, and semiconductors |
12% |
Communication Systems |
Bandwidth of signals, propagation of electromagnetic waves, modulation |
8% |
